That program, they called it 'Working Holiday Visa', which they have already suspended due to the misuse of the visa by certain applicant. They applied it, and then after two years, they stayed at Illegal in the UK. I got this Visa two years ago, I was lucky that time, because they allowed us to work full time, 12 months working in the UK you are allow to switch to work permit, but this provided your employer wants to sponsor you. I am lucky enough that my employer got me 3 years work permit after my working holiday visa expired.
